(EnergyAsia, September 23 2011, Friday) — Stung by the recent surge in liquefied natural gas (LNG) prices, Thai state energy firm PTT said it has cancelled a million-tonne order from Qatar in favour of alternative suppliers. Asian spot LNG prices have more than doubled to over US$16 million BTU since the March 11 earthquake-tsunami tragedy…
